linux iptables прокси

🔑 Туннельное шифрование 👁️ Защита от слежки 📡 Безопасные каналы 🚫 Защита от перехвата 🌐 Шифрование трафика DNS 🔗 Безопасное соединение

linux iptables прокси

image
image

Linux iptables прокси: как настроить и обеспечить безопасность

В современном мире, когда безопасность и приватность в сети выходят на первый план, использование прокси-серверов стало практически необходимостью. Особенно актуально это для пользователей и администраторов Linux, которым важно контролировать трафик, скрывать IP-адреса или обходить блокировки. В этой статье разберемся, как настроить linux iptables прокси и сделать его максимально эффективным и безопасным.

Что такое linux iptables и прокси?

iptables — это мощный инструмент для настройки фильтрации и маршрутизации сетевого трафика в Linux. Он позволяет создавать правила, которые управляют входящими и исходящими соединениями, обеспечивая безопасность системы.

Прокси-сервер — это промежуточное звено между пользователем и интернетом, которое выполняет функции кеширования, аутентификации и фильтрации. Использование прокси помогает повысить приватность, ускорить доступ к сайтам и контролировать использование сети.

Объединяя эти два инструмента, можно настроить linux iptables прокси — это, по сути, прокси, управляемый через правила iptables, что дает гибкость и контроль на уровне ядра.

Почему именно iptables для прокси?

  • Высокая производительность: iptables работает на уровне ядра, что обеспечивает минимальную задержку.
  • Гибкость: можно настроить правила для различных протоколов и портов.
  • Контроль и безопасность: легко блокировать нежелательный трафик и ограничивать доступ.

Как настроить linux iptables прокси

Рассмотрим пример — настройка простого HTTP-прокси на базе iptables.

Шаг 1. Установка необходимых пакетов

Для работы потребуется установить iptables и, например, tinyproxy или любой другой легкий прокси-сервер.

sudo apt update
sudo apt install tinyproxy

Шаг 2. Настройка прокси-сервера

Отредактируйте конфигурационный файл /etc/tinyproxy/tinyproxy.conf, указав порт, IP-адрес и другие параметры.

Шаг 3. Настройка правил iptables

Теперь создадим правила для перенаправления трафика на порт прокси.

Разрешаем входящие соединения на порт прокси
sudo iptables -A INPUT -p tcp --dport 8888 -j ACCEPT

Перенаправляем весь исходящий HTTP-трафик на порт прокси
sudo iptables -t nat -A PREROUTING -p tcp --dport 80 -j REDIRECT --to-port 8888

Шаг 4. Сохранение правил

Чтобы правила сохранились после перезагрузки, используйте:

sudo iptables-save > /etc/iptables/rules.v4

или соответствующую команду для вашей системы.

Советы по безопасности и оптимизации

  • Используйте только нужные порты и протоколы.
  • Ограничьте доступ к прокси только доверенными IP.
  • Регулярно обновляйте систему и правила iptables.
  • Рассмотрите возможность использования VPN в сочетании с iptables для усиления приватности.

Итог

Настройка linux iptables прокси — это мощный способ повысить безопасность сети, контролировать трафик и сохранить приватность. Такой подход подойдет как для домашних пользователей, так и для небольших предприятий. Главное — правильно настроить правила и следить за их актуальностью.

Если вам нужна более сложная конфигурация или автоматизация — ищите дополнительные инструменты и скрипты, создавайте свои сценарии. В мире информационной безопасности нет универсальных решений, важна гибкость и понимание своих задач.

🔑 Туннельное шифрование 👁️ Защита от слежки 📡 Безопасные каналы 🚫 Защита от перехвата 🌐 Шифрование трафика DNS 🔗 Безопасное соединение

Присоединиться к обсуждению

Комментариев пока нет.

Оставить комментарий

Решите простую математическую задачу для защиты от ботов